Output 8180b10511b07c6c4166f120eaa4997c407ce1694b0d23008213593eec90833d:0

value
733000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f5bbe4a56cfcfbb32c5234951bf76362bb98a27 OP_EQUAL
address
3Em2TQvSnUVDMoUgoYZdZ4SMkRk7uw5RgV
transaction
8180b10511b07c6c4166f120eaa4997c407ce1694b0d23008213593eec90833d
confirmations
133717
spent
true